Skip to content

Commit 5784da7

Browse files
committed
Fixed pr issues
1 parent a99bf3c commit 5784da7

6 files changed

Lines changed: 27 additions & 11 deletions

File tree

src/main/java/com/crowdin/client/styleguide/StyleGuidesApi.java

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-81,12 +81,12 @@ public ResponseObject<StyleGuide> addStyleGuide(AddStyleGuideRequest request) th
8181
* <li><a href="https://developer.crowdin.com/enterprise/api/v2/#operation/api.style-guides.getMany" target="_blank"><b>Enterprise API Documentation</b></a></li>
8282
* </ul>
8383
*/
84-
public ResponseList<StyleGuide> listStyleGuide(Long userId, Integer limit, Integer offset) throws HttpException, HttpBadRequestException {
84+
public ResponseList<StyleGuide> listStyleGuides(Long userId, Integer limit, Integer offset) throws HttpException, HttpBadRequestException {
8585
ListStyleGuidesParams params = new ListStyleGuidesParams();
8686
params.setUserId(userId);
8787
params.setLimit(limit);
8888
params.setOffset(offset);
89-
return listStyleGuide(params);
89+
return listStyleGuides(params);
9090
}
9191

9292
/**
@@ -100,16 +100,16 @@ public ResponseList<StyleGuide> listStyleGuide(Long userId, Integer limit, Integ
100100
* <li><a href="https://developer.crowdin.com/enterprise/api/v2/#operation/api.style-guides.getMany" target="_blank"><b>Enterprise API Documentation</b></a></li>
101101
* </ul>
102102
*/
103-
public ResponseList<StyleGuide> listStyleGuide(Long userId, Integer limit, Integer offset, List<OrderByField> orderBy) throws HttpException, HttpBadRequestException {
103+
public ResponseList<StyleGuide> listStyleGuides(Long userId, Integer limit, Integer offset, List<OrderByField> orderBy) throws HttpException, HttpBadRequestException {
104104
ListStyleGuidesParams params = new ListStyleGuidesParams();
105105
params.setUserId(userId);
106106
params.setLimit(limit);
107107
params.setOffset(offset);
108108
params.setOrderByList(orderBy);
109-
return listStyleGuide(params);
109+
return listStyleGuides(params);
110110
}
111111

112-
public ResponseList<StyleGuide> listStyleGuide(ListStyleGuidesParams params) {
112+
public ResponseList<StyleGuide> listStyleGuides(ListStyleGuidesParams params) throws HttpException, HttpBadRequestException {
113113
ListStyleGuidesParams query = Optional.ofNullable(params).orElse(new ListStyleGuidesParams());
114114

115115
String orderBy = query.getOrderByList() != null

src/test/java/com/crowdin/client/styleguide/StyleGuidesApiStyleGuidesOrderByIdAscTest.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-35,7 +35,7 @@ public void listStyleGuidesTest_orderByIdNull() {
3535
OrderByField orderById = new OrderByField();
3636
orderById.setFieldName("id");
3737

38-
ResponseList<StyleGuide> styleGuideResponseList = this.getStyleGuidesApi().listStyleGuide(null, null, null, singletonList(orderById));
38+
ResponseList<StyleGuide> styleGuideResponseList = this.getStyleGuidesApi().listStyleGuides(null, null, null, singletonList(orderById));
3939
assertEquals(2, styleGuideResponseList.getData().size());
4040
assertEquals(styleGuideId, styleGuideResponseList.getData().get(0).getData().getId());
4141
assertEquals(styleGuide2Id, styleGuideResponseList.getData().get(1).getData().getId());
@@ -47,7 +47,7 @@ public void listStyleGuidesTest_orderByIdAsc() {
4747
orderById.setFieldName("id");
4848
orderById.setOrderBy(SortOrder.ASC);
4949

50-
ResponseList<StyleGuide> styleGuideResponseList = this.getStyleGuidesApi().listStyleGuide(null, null, null, singletonList(orderById));
50+
ResponseList<StyleGuide> styleGuideResponseList = this.getStyleGuidesApi().listStyleGuides(null, null, null, singletonList(orderById));
5151
assertEquals(2, styleGuideResponseList.getData().size());
5252
assertEquals(styleGuideId, styleGuideResponseList.getData().get(0).getData().getId());
5353
assertEquals(styleGuide2Id, styleGuideResponseList.getData().get(1).getData().getId());

src/test/java/com/crowdin/client/styleguide/StyleGuidesApiStyleGuidesOrderByIdDescTest.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-36,7 +36,7 @@ public void listStyleGuidesTest_orderByIdDesc() {
3636
orderById.setFieldName("id");
3737
orderById.setOrderBy(SortOrder.DESC);
3838

39-
ResponseList<StyleGuide> styleGuideResponseList = this.getStyleGuidesApi().listStyleGuide(null, null, null, singletonList(orderById));
39+
ResponseList<StyleGuide> styleGuideResponseList = this.getStyleGuidesApi().listStyleGuides(null, null, null, singletonList(orderById));
4040
assertEquals(2, styleGuideResponseList.getData().size());
4141
assertEquals(styleGuide2Id, styleGuideResponseList.getData().get(0).getData().getId());
4242
assertEquals(styleGuideId, styleGuideResponseList.getData().get(1).getData().getId());

src/test/java/com/crowdin/client/styleguide/StyleGuidesApiTest.java

Lines changed: 17 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-43,10 +43,14 @@ public List<RequestMock> getMocks() {
4343

4444
@Test
4545
public void listStyleGuidesTest() {
46-
ResponseList<StyleGuide> styleGuideResponseList = this.getStyleGuidesApi().listStyleGuide(null, null, null);
46+
ResponseList<StyleGuide> styleGuideResponseList = this.getStyleGuidesApi().listStyleGuides(null, null, null);
4747
assertEquals(styleGuideResponseList.getData().size(), 1);
4848
assertEquals(styleGuideResponseList.getData().get(0).getData().getId(), styleGuideId);
4949
assertEquals(styleGuideResponseList.getData().get(0).getData().getName(), name);
50+
assertEquals(styleGuideResponseList.getData().get(0).getData().getAiInstructions(), aiInstructions);
51+
assertEquals(styleGuideResponseList.getData().get(0).getData().getIsShared(), isShared);
52+
assertEquals(styleGuideResponseList.getData().get(0).getData().getLanguageIds(), languageIds);
53+
assertEquals(styleGuideResponseList.getData().get(0).getData().getProjectIds(), projectIds);
5054
}
5155

5256
@Test
@@ -61,13 +65,21 @@ public void addStyleGuideTest() {
6165
ResponseObject<StyleGuide> styleGuideResponseObject = this.getStyleGuidesApi().addStyleGuide(request);
6266
assertEquals(styleGuideResponseObject.getData().getId(), styleGuideId);
6367
assertEquals(styleGuideResponseObject.getData().getName(), name);
68+
assertEquals(styleGuideResponseObject.getData().getAiInstructions(), aiInstructions);
69+
assertEquals(styleGuideResponseObject.getData().getIsShared(), isShared);
70+
assertEquals(styleGuideResponseObject.getData().getLanguageIds(), languageIds);
71+
assertEquals(styleGuideResponseObject.getData().getProjectIds(), projectIds);
6472
}
6573

6674
@Test
6775
public void getStyleGuideTest() {
6876
ResponseObject<StyleGuide> styleGuideResponseObject = this.getStyleGuidesApi().getStyleGuide(styleGuideId);
6977
assertEquals(styleGuideResponseObject.getData().getId(), styleGuideId);
7078
assertEquals(styleGuideResponseObject.getData().getName(), name);
79+
assertEquals(styleGuideResponseObject.getData().getAiInstructions(), aiInstructions);
80+
assertEquals(styleGuideResponseObject.getData().getIsShared(), isShared);
81+
assertEquals(styleGuideResponseObject.getData().getLanguageIds(), languageIds);
82+
assertEquals(styleGuideResponseObject.getData().getProjectIds(), projectIds);
7183
}
7284

7385
@Test
@@ -84,5 +96,9 @@ public void editStyleGuideTest() {
8496
ResponseObject<StyleGuide> styleGuideResponseObject = this.getStyleGuidesApi().editStyleGuide(styleGuideId, singletonList(request));
8597
assertEquals(styleGuideResponseObject.getData().getId(), styleGuideId);
8698
assertEquals(styleGuideResponseObject.getData().getName(), name);
99+
assertEquals(styleGuideResponseObject.getData().getAiInstructions(), aiInstructions);
100+
assertEquals(styleGuideResponseObject.getData().getIsShared(), isShared);
101+
assertEquals(styleGuideResponseObject.getData().getLanguageIds(), languageIds);
102+
assertEquals(styleGuideResponseObject.getData().getProjectIds(), projectIds);
87103
}
88104
}

src/test/resources/api/styleguide/listStyleGuides.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66
"name": "Be My Eyes iOS's Style Guide",
77
"aiInstructions": "string",
88
"userId": 2,
9-
"languageId": ["uk", "fr", "de"],
9+
"languageIds": ["uk", "fr", "de"],
1010
"projectIds": [1, 2, 3],
1111
"isShared": false,
1212
"createdAt": "2019-09-16T13:42:04+00:00"

src/test/resources/api/styleguide/styleGuide.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
"name": "Be My Eyes iOS's Style Guide",
55
"aiInstructions": "string",
66
"userId": 2,
7-
"languageId": ["uk", "fr", "de"],
7+
"languageIds": ["uk", "fr", "de"],
88
"projectIds": [1, 2, 3],
99
"isShared": false,
1010
"createdAt": "2019-09-16T13:42:04+00:00"

0 commit comments

Comments
 (0)